My dog ate lollies. Is it safe if my dog ate party mix candy?

Updated on September 23rd, 2025

Pet's info: Dog | Cocker Spaniel | Female

My dog got into half a packet of allens party mix lollies, I'm not sure when but will she be okay?

Hi and thanks for using Petco Pet Education Center, formerly Petcoach! Sorry to hear about Louey. Here are the ingredients I found from Google-

Ingredients: Glucose Syrup (Wheat or Corn), Cane Sugar, Thickener (1401 or 1420)(Wheat), Gelatine, Food Acid (Citric), Flavours, Colours (171, 120, 160c, 160a, 153, 100, 141).
Contains Wheat. Made on equipment that also processes products containing Milk.

Nothing in here is a big concern, mostly glucose/sugar. An ingestion like this (dietary indiscretion) sometimes will lead to nausea, vomiting, and/or diarrhea. I would monitor and be on the lookout for these problems/signs. If these signs develop, I would contact your vet unless they resolve quickly. Your vet can advise if the signs persist. Good luck with Louey and keep her out of the sweets!
